Why should a pregnant woman consider attending childbirth classes?

Explanation:
Attending childbirth classes is highly beneficial for pregnant women as it directly contributes to improving labor skills. These classes provide essential information about the childbirth process, pain management techniques, breathing exercises, and positions that can aid in labor. By learning and practicing these skills, women can feel more prepared and empowered, which may enhance their overall experience during labor. Childbirth classes also encourage confidence in mothers-to-be, as they will have the knowledge to make informed decisions during labor and delivery. This preparation can improve communication with healthcare providers and support persons, leading to a more positive birth experience. In addition to practical skills, these classes often foster a support network among participants, though that is more of a secondary benefit than the primary focus on skill development. While attending classes may have a positive influence on aspects like the duration of labor or cesarean risk, the primary reason they are recommended is to enhance the skills expected to support women during labor effectively.

The Davis Advantage Maternal-Newborn Practice Test covers a wide range of topics pertinent to maternal and newborn health care. Here are some core subjects you should be prepared for:

  1. Prenatal Care: Understanding the physiological changes in pregnancy, prenatal health assessments, and nutritional needs.
  2. Labor and Delivery: Knowledge of the stages of labor, birth processes, pain management, and obstetric complications.
  3. Postpartum Care: Insight into maternal recovery, breastfeeding techniques, and postpartum complications.
  4. Newborn Care: Proficiency in newborn assessments, common neonatal conditions, and essential newborn care practices.
  5. Family Dynamics: Interaction with family members during prenatal and postnatal care, including cultural competencies and education.

These areas not only test your theoretical understanding but also your capability to apply knowledge in practical situations.
